ポリゴン(MATIC)のネットワーク性能を解説
ポリゴン(MATIC)は、イーサリアムのスケーラビリティ問題を解決するために開発されたレイヤー2ソリューションです。本稿では、ポリゴンのネットワーク性能について、そのアーキテクチャ、コンセンサスメカニズム、トランザクション処理能力、セキュリティ、そして将来的な展望を含めて詳細に解説します。
1. ポリゴンのアーキテクチャ
ポリゴンは、プルーフ・オブ・ステーク(PoS)に基づくサイドチェーンを利用するフレームワークです。イーサリアムメインネットと互換性があり、イーサリアム仮想マシン(EVM)をサポートしているため、既存のイーサリアムアプリケーションを比較的容易にポリゴンに移行できます。ポリゴンのアーキテクチャは、主に以下の要素で構成されています。
- ポリゴンチェーン: PoSコンセンサスに基づいたメインのサイドチェーンであり、トランザクションの処理とブロックの生成を行います。
- ブリッジ: イーサリアムメインネットとポリゴンチェーン間のアセットの移動を可能にする仕組みです。
- Plasmaフレームワーク: ポリゴンは、Plasmaの技術を基盤としており、オフチェーンでのトランザクション処理を可能にします。
- コミットメントチェーン: オフチェーンで処理されたトランザクションのデータを、ポリゴンチェーンに定期的にコミットメントすることで、セキュリティを確保します。
このアーキテクチャにより、ポリゴンはイーサリアムのセキュリティを維持しつつ、より高速かつ低コストなトランザクション処理を実現しています。
2. コンセンサスメカニズム
ポリゴンは、プルーフ・オブ・ステーク(PoS)コンセンサスを採用しています。PoSは、トランザクションの検証とブロックの生成を、トークンをステーク(預け入れ)したバリデーターに委ねる仕組みです。バリデーターは、ステークしたトークンの量に応じて選出され、不正な行為を行った場合にはステークしたトークンを没収されるリスクがあります。これにより、ネットワークのセキュリティが確保されます。
ポリゴンのPoSコンセンサスには、以下の特徴があります。
- チェックポインター: イーサリアムメインネットの状態を定期的にポリゴンチェーンに同期させる役割を担います。
- バリデーター: トランザクションの検証とブロックの生成を行います。
- デリゲーター: 自身でバリデーターになる代わりに、バリデーターにトークンを委任することで、ネットワークの運営に参加できます。
PoSコンセンサスは、プルーフ・オブ・ワーク(PoW)と比較して、エネルギー消費量が少なく、より環境に優しいという利点があります。
3. トランザクション処理能力
ポリゴンのトランザクション処理能力は、イーサリアムと比較して大幅に向上しています。イーサリアムのトランザクション処理能力は、1秒あたり約15トランザクションですが、ポリゴンは1秒あたり数千トランザクションを処理できます。これは、ポリゴンのサイドチェーンアーキテクチャとPoSコンセンサスによるものです。
ポリゴンのトランザクション処理能力は、ネットワークの混雑状況によって変動しますが、平均的には以下のようになっています。
- トランザクション処理速度: 1~2秒
- トランザクション手数料: 数セント
- ブロック生成時間: 約2秒
これらの数値は、イーサリアムと比較して、大幅に高速かつ低コストであることを示しています。これにより、ポリゴンは、DeFi(分散型金融)やNFT(非代替性トークン)などのアプリケーションにとって、魅力的なプラットフォームとなっています。
4. セキュリティ
ポリゴンのセキュリティは、イーサリアムのセキュリティに依存しています。ポリゴンは、イーサリアムのセキュリティを継承しつつ、独自のセキュリティ対策を講じることで、ネットワークの安全性を高めています。
ポリゴンのセキュリティ対策には、以下のものが含まれます。
- PoSコンセンサス: 不正なバリデーターの行為を抑制し、ネットワークの整合性を維持します。
- ブリッジのセキュリティ: イーサリアムメインネットとポリゴンチェーン間のアセットの移動を安全に行うための仕組みです。
- 監査: 外部のセキュリティ専門家による定期的な監査を実施し、脆弱性を特定して修正します。
- バグ報奨金プログラム: セキュリティ上の脆弱性を発見した人に報奨金を提供することで、ネットワークのセキュリティ向上を促します。
これらのセキュリティ対策により、ポリゴンは、安全なプラットフォームとして、多くのユーザーや開発者から信頼を得ています。
5. ポリゴンの将来的な展望
ポリゴンは、イーサリアムのスケーラビリティ問題を解決するための重要なソリューションとして、今後も成長していくことが予想されます。ポリゴンの開発チームは、ネットワークの性能向上と機能拡張に向けて、継続的に開発を進めています。
ポリゴンの将来的な展望には、以下のものが含まれます。
- ポリゴン2.0: より高度なスケーラビリティとセキュリティを実現するためのアップグレードです。
- ZK-Rollupsの統合: ゼロ知識証明(ZK)技術を活用したロールアップを統合することで、トランザクション処理能力をさらに向上させます。
- 相互運用性の向上: 他のブロックチェーンとの相互運用性を高めることで、より広範なエコシステムを構築します。
- DeFiとNFTの拡大: DeFiやNFTなどのアプリケーションのサポートを強化し、より多くのユーザーと開発者を引きつけます。
これらの展望により、ポリゴンは、Web3の未来を担う重要なプラットフォームとなる可能性があります。
6. ポリゴンの課題
ポリゴンは多くの利点を持つ一方で、いくつかの課題も抱えています。これらの課題を克服することで、ポリゴンはより成熟したプラットフォームへと進化していくでしょう。
- 中央集権化のリスク: PoSコンセンサスにおけるバリデーターの集中化は、ネットワークの中央集権化のリスクを高める可能性があります。
- ブリッジのセキュリティ: ブリッジは、ハッキングの標的となりやすく、セキュリティ対策の強化が必要です。
- ネットワークの混雑: ポリゴンチェーンの利用者が増加すると、ネットワークが混雑し、トランザクション手数料が高騰する可能性があります。
これらの課題に対して、ポリゴンの開発チームは、積極的に対策を講じています。
まとめ
ポリゴン(MATIC)は、イーサリアムのスケーラビリティ問題を解決するための有望なレイヤー2ソリューションです。PoSコンセンサス、サイドチェーンアーキテクチャ、そして継続的な開発により、ポリゴンは、高速かつ低コストなトランザクション処理を実現し、DeFiやNFTなどのアプリケーションにとって、魅力的なプラットフォームとなっています。今後の開発と課題の克服により、ポリゴンは、Web3の未来を担う重要なプラットフォームとなることが期待されます。